By the editors · 2 min readPassionate opens with a bright citrus-floral accord — orange blossom and bergamot shimmering against lemon in a clean, luminous opening. Jasmine, lily of the valley, and rose at the heart form a classic white-floral triptych, lush without heaviness, the kind of floral that was considered benchmark femininity in the early 80s. Tonka, benzoin, and amber in the base warm the composition into a soft oriental finish, cedar providing structure. This is a well-crafted feminine floral oriental, unpretentious and elegantly assembled — the kind of fragrance that doesn't need to explain itself. It simply works, in the tradition of its era.
